Tapfiliate vs Syndicate Links

Tapfiliate is an affiliate tracking platform for merchants who need click-based attribution, a clean dashboard, and a self-managed publisher program. It works well when publishers share referral links, buyers click them, and conversion tracking runs through browser cookies (or server-to-server postbacks).

Syndicate Links addresses a different problem: attribution for AI agents that refer buyers through autonomous recommendations, without clicking links or triggering browser events. There is also a practical pricing difference worth understanding before you pick a plan: Tapfiliate's headline subscription is only half the picture once click and conversion overages kick in.

Tapfiliate: click-based affiliate tracking

Tapfiliate gives merchants a self-contained affiliate program with no network fees or marketplace dependencies. You own the publisher relationships and track performance directly.

The platform covers the standard affiliate program workflow:

  • Referral link generation and click tracking
  • Conversion attribution via browser cookies and S2S/postback integrations
  • Multi-level commission support
  • Publisher dashboard where affiliates log in to check performance and access materials
  • Affiliate payment methods (including automated payouts on Scale via Trolley)
  • Integrations with Shopify, WooCommerce, BigCommerce, Stripe, and 30+ other platforms

Pricing (verified 2026-07-09):

PlanMonthlyAnnual (billed yearly)Included clicksClick overageIncluded conversionsConversion overage
Launch$89/mo$74/mo ($890/year)5,000 / mo$1.50 / 1,000500 / mo$15 / 1,000
Scale$179/mo$149/mo ($1,790/year)100,000 / mo$1.00 / 1,00010,000 / mo$10 / 1,000
EnterpriseCustomCustomTailoredTailoredTailoredTailored

Monthly billing is available on Launch and Scale. Annual plans discount the monthly-equivalent rate (two months free on the annual commitment). For growing programs, the overage rows matter more than the headline subscription: both clicks and conversions have separate overage fees that stack on top of the base plan.

The attribution model is still click- and cookie-centered (with traditional S2S postbacks). Tapfiliate's own feature comparison table lists AI Agent Integration (MCP) as Coming soon. That is a roadmap signal, not a shipped product. As of July 2026, there is no public agent-native credential, signed attribution token, or conversion path that works when the "publisher" is an AI agent with no browser session.

Tapfiliate pricing and feature table verified at tapfiliate.com/pricing on 2026-07-09.

Syndicate Links: attribution infrastructure for AI agent publishers

Syndicate Links tracks conversions that never touch a browser. The core use case is AI agent publishers: a user asks their AI assistant which SaaS tool to use, the agent evaluates options and makes a recommendation, the user buys. That referral should be attributed and compensated. Cookie windows and click caps do not cover it.

The tracking mechanism is different from cookie-based attribution by design:

  • aff_agent_ keys issued to AI agent publishers as cryptographic identifiers
  • slat_v1 tokens (SLAT - Syndicate Links Attribution Token) signed with HMAC-SHA256, encoding the agent identity, the recommended product, and a timestamp
  • When payment occurs via x402, the SLAT token is embedded as an atxp_reference in the payment proof, so attribution is verified at the transaction rather than reconciled afterward
  • MCP server is live (npx syndicate-links-mcp), not a "coming soon" row

For programs not running AI agent publishers yet, the practical differences are simpler: no click overage fees, no conversion overage fees, platform fee based on commissions paid (not traffic volume), server-side webhooks for SaaS trial-to-paid events, and payout rails beyond the usual affiliate payout stack.

Frequently asked questions

Does Syndicate Links charge per click or per conversion?

No. Attribution events fire on payment confirmation, not click volume or conversion counts. There are no click caps, conversion caps, or overage fees. Merchants pay a platform fee on commissions paid out (5% on Starter, 2.5% on Pro, with volume discounts).

Can Tapfiliate track AI agent referrals today?

Not as a shipped product. As of July 2026, Tapfiliate's public pricing/feature table lists AI Agent Integration (MCP) as Coming soon. The live product is still oriented around referral links, cookies, and traditional S2S postbacks. Referrals from AI assistants or autonomous agents with no browser session are not covered by that model today. Syndicate Links ships native agent credentials, signed SLAT tokens, and an MCP server.

Is monthly billing available on Tapfiliate?

Yes. Launch is $89/month and Scale is $179/month when billed monthly. Annual billing drops those to $74/month ($890/year) and $149/month ($1,790/year). The flexibility gap is not "monthly vs annual only." It is overage structure and agent support.

Is Syndicate Links more expensive than Tapfiliate at scale?

Depends on the math. Tapfiliate charges $89-$179/month (or annual equivalents) plus click overages and conversion overages once you leave the included caps. Syndicate Links charges $0-$79/month plus 2.5-5% of commissions paid, with no traffic overages. For programs with high click/conversion volume and moderate commission payouts, Syndicate Links often comes out cheaper. For programs with low traffic and high commission payouts, Tapfiliate's zero platform fee can be competitive. Run the numbers on our pricing page.
